Nestled in the picturesque countryside of East Sussex, Buxted Train Station serves as a charming gateway to both rural idylls and vibrant urban adventures. Located on the Uckfield Branch Line, this station is a stepping stone for travelers eager to explore the scenic landscapes surrounding Uckfield, as well as adventurous journeys to bustling destinations such as London Bridge, East Croydon, and beyond.
Buxted Train Station is equipped with several essential facilities to make your journey as smooth as possible. Ticket purchasing is a breeze with the on-site office open during convenient hours from early morning till just after midday on weekdays and Saturdays. Ticket machines are also available, equipped for ease of use for all passengers, including those with reduced mobility, offering discounts through the Disabled Persons Railcard.
While this charming station doesn’t boast a large selection of shops or refreshment facilities, it does feature CCTV for added security and an induction loop for hearing aid users. Accessibility is a major priority here, with step-free access available throughout the station via side gates or the ticket office, ensuring an inclusive experience for everyone.
For those eager to explore further afield, Buxted Station offers excellent transportation links. Bus connections are available to help passengers navigate their onward journeys with ease. During planned works or disruptions, a rail replacement service may also be deployed, ensuring that travel plans remain seamless and uninterrupted.

Nestled in the quiet, picturesque surroundings of Berkshire, Iver station is an often-overlooked gem in the world of UK rail travel. Whether you’re planning a leisurely trip or looking for a convenient commute, the station offers an excellent starting point, especially for journeys leading into London and beyond. Let’s delve into the facilities and services this station has to offer, so you can plan your next journey with ease.
Iver station is well-equipped to assist passengers with accessibility needs, offering step-free access throughout, ramps for train access, and accessible ticket machines located in the ticket hall. This makes traveling easy and convenient for everyone. You can collect your pre-purchased tickets from the machine available at the station, ensuring you can grab your tickets hassle-free. Plan your journey in advance and remember that staff are on hand to provide assistance through designated help points and at the ticket office.
The station features essential amenities to ensure a comfortable wait for your train. Whilst there are no dedicated waiting room offices, seating areas with multiple uncovered seats are available on platforms 3 and 4. Toilets, including accessible ones, are located conveniently in the ticket hall, keeping all the necessities close to hand. However, do note that there are no refreshment facilities or shops, so planning ahead on snacks and drinks is advised.
For those looking to explore further or connect to other transport, Iver station is a brilliant hub. To reach Heathrow Airport, simply take the Elizabeth Line and change at Hayes & Harlington. Alternatively, head over to West Drayton Station for a 350 bus connection. During any rail disruption, the station offers a rail replacement service departing from Bathurst Walk near the station’s entrance.
